Cabool Enterprise, Thursday, September 10, 1970

DAN HENRY ALTIS

Dan Henry Altis was born in Redwood, Roanoke County, Virginia, July 10, 1885 and died at Texas County Memorial Hospital, Houston, Missouri Sept. 5, 1970 having attained the age of 85 years, one month and 25 days.

He was the fifth of 11 children born to Samuel and Harriett Altis and moved with his family to a homestead north of Cabool, Missouri, when four months old.

Dan was married to Alma Ross April 10, 1911. She died six years later, June 3, 1917. He married Mable Ninetta Gill June 12, 1919. She also preceded him in death February 23, 1969.

Dan professed a saving faith in Jesus Christ as a young man and joined the Hamilton Creek Church. Nov. 2. 1930 he became a charter member of the Providence Freewill Baptist Church, was ordained to the deacon board and served the church faithfully in that capacity until his death.

Two sons preceded him in death in childhood leaving three sons, Vern and Roscoe of Cabool and Clifford of Independence, Missouri, and one daughter Doris Altis of Independence, Missouri to survive him. Also surviving are six grandchildren, ten great grandchildren, two sisters, May Crossland and Ada Schoers both of Cabool, three brothers Willard and Paul of Cabool and Ezra of Columbia, Missouri and many friends.

Services were held Tuesday afternoon in the Providence Freewill Baptist Church with Rev. Ezra Butts, Ramey Gass and Don Ratterree officiating. Burial was in the church cemetery under direction of Elliott-Gentry Funeral Home.




The family changed their name from Altick to Altis when they moved from VA to MO in late 1885.
